In Little Elm, compounded GLP-1 medications generally cost $200 to $450 monthly, while brand-name Wegovy or Mounjaro can run $1,000 or more without insurance. Several Texas clinics offer payment plans to help manage the expense.
Insurance coverage for GLP-1 medications in Texas depends on your plan. Some commercial insurers cover Wegovy or Zepbound with prior authorization and a BMI-based qualification. Check with your Little Elm provider about which plans they work with, and whether they can help with the authorization process.
Telehealth GLP-1 programs are available to Little Elm residents through both local clinics and national platforms. Texas allows telehealth prescribing for most GLP-1 medications, making it possible to start treatment without an in-person visit.
